I'm struggling with applying the sidecars - xmp files. I tried looking
at the manual and section
https://www.darktable.org/usermanual/en/overview/sidecar-files/sidecar-import/
seems to be most relevant. The problem I face is when I download the
image and corresponding xmp files, everyone names it differently based
on their choice or completely inverse scenario where file is named as
exactly same by many. I have to remember to name it correctly and save
it in right directory. Default browser saving format is also not very
friendly to darktable sidecar reading logic.
Is there a feature in darktable where I can just say, take this xmp file
and apply it to the current image? I think this is similar to creating
style from history stack, but source will be xmp file but could not
easily figure it out.
